Consumer Sentiment Slips: The University of Michigan reported that its index on consumer sentiment decreased to 92.1 at mid-March from 93.2 for all of February, according to market participants who saw the report, which is released only to subscribers. The index is composed of two parts: consumer sentiment on the future and current conditions. The index for consumer expectations rose to 84.9 in March from 83.5 in February. However, consumer sentiment on current economic conditions dropped to 103.4 from 108.3.
